Can you give me step-by-step instructions for re-formatting my Hard drive?

Question

I emailed gateway tech support and I have yet to receive an answer after a week. Can you give me a step by step process on how to reformat my hard drive and install the drivers for the drives or tell me where to find the info?

I also have a Gateway G5-166 machine, not a laptop. I found that by calling their Gold Premium Support at 1-800-555-3002, they are more than happy to help. The process is lengthy and can extend (in my experience) 2 to 3 hours.

You first have to Fdisk your hard drive, and clean everything off of it. Then you reformat the hard drive. I use only one drive as the active primary drive, for simplicity. I then install the operating system Windows 95. Then when windows 95 is installed, I install the display drivers from my Gateway System CD. I use the ATI Rage II+ (Direct Draw) drivers. Do not restart when asked, and then install the audio drivers on the System CD. I use the Ensonig PCI drivers. Do not restart when asked. Then the mouse drivers, and keyboard drivers, and the UATA drivers. Now, finally restart your computer to finish the installation process. This should do it, but if it doesn't work right you can always call a tech at Gateway at 1-800-555-3002.
